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

Cryptography

Cryptography, or cryptology is the practice and study of techniques for secure communication in the presence of adversarial behavior. More generally, cryptography is about constructing and analyzing protocols that prevent third parties or the public from reading private messages.

https://github.com/tendermint/yubihsm-rs

Pure Rust client for YubiHSM2 devices

cryptography digital-signatures ecdsa ed25519 hsm rust yubico yubihsm

Last synced: 06 Nov 2024

https://github.com/karasiq/shadowcloud

Universal cloud storage client

cloudstorage cryptography scala

Last synced: 14 Nov 2024

https://github.com/mrrazvi/blockchain-development

A complimentary course for an understanding of blockchain and its development like custom blockchain, dapps, etc.

bitcoin blockchain course cryptography dapps ethereum roadmap security smart-contracts

Last synced: 17 Nov 2024

https://github.com/paulmillr/scure-starknet

Audited & minimal JS implementation of Starknet cryptography.

cryptography pedersen poseidon stark stark-curve starkex starknet

Last synced: 12 Nov 2024

https://github.com/frankmorgner/openpace

Cryptographic library for EAC version 2

c certificate cryptography eac mrtd openssl pace smartcard

Last synced: 15 Nov 2024

https://github.com/ZenGo-X/multi-party-bls

Threshold BLS signatures in Rust

cryptography

Last synced: 09 Nov 2024

https://github.com/posener/sharedsecret

Implementation of Shamir's Secret Sharing algorithm.

algorithms cryptography go golang secret-sharing shamir-secret-sharing sss

Last synced: 22 Oct 2024

https://github.com/screetsec/imr0t

imR0T: Send a quick message with simple text encryption to your whatsapp contact and protect your text by encrypting and decrypting, basically in ROT13 with new multi encryption based algorithm on ASCII and Symbols Substitution

bash-script cryptography encryption-algorithms encryption-decryption encryption-tool hacking-tool kali-linux rot13 symbolic-manipulation whatsapp-api

Last synced: 07 Nov 2024

https://github.com/jedisct1/rust-sthash

Very fast cryptographic hashing for large messages.

crypto cryptography digest fast hash nhpoly1305 rust uhf

Last synced: 13 Nov 2024

https://github.com/kudelskisecurity/EdDSA-fault-attack

Fault attack agaisnt EdDSA demonstrated on an Arduino Nano board, allowing for partial key recovery and fake signatures.

arduino-nano attack cryptography eddsa fault-attack faulted-signatures hardware-security research

Last synced: 14 Aug 2024

https://github.com/sodium-friends/sodium-universal

Universal wrapper for sodium-javascript and sodium-native working in Node.js and the Browser

browser cryptography libsodium nodejs universal

Last synced: 11 Nov 2024

https://github.com/exonum/exonum-client

JavaScript client for Exonum blockchain

blockchain cryptography ed25519 exonum merkle-tree sha256

Last synced: 10 Nov 2024

https://github.com/r4sas/pbincli

PrivateBin CLI on python 3

crypto cryptography paste privatebin python python3

Last synced: 13 Nov 2024

https://github.com/erhant/moonmath

Solutions to exercises from MoonMath Manual to zkSNARKs.

algebra cryptography mathematics sage web3 zero-knowledge

Last synced: 13 Nov 2024

https://github.com/tniessen/node-pqclean

PQClean for Node.js, Deno, and browsers 🔏🔑 Node.js native addon and WebAssembly implementation

cryptography deno javascript nodejs npm-package post-quantum post-quantum-cryptography post-quantum-kem post-quantum-signature webassembly

Last synced: 30 Oct 2024

https://github.com/algertc/homebrew-kleopatra4mac

Kleopatra4Mac is an all-in-one prebuilt port of KDE's GPG utility for use on MacOS.

arm bottle crypto cryptography gnu gnupg gpg homebrew kde m1 m1-mac mac macos pgp

Last synced: 30 Oct 2024

https://github.com/r4sas/PBinCLI

PrivateBin CLI on python 3

crypto cryptography paste privatebin python python3

Last synced: 31 Oct 2024

https://github.com/wolfssl/wolfssljni

wolfSSL JSSE provider and JNI wrapper for SSL/TLS, supporting up to TLS 1.3!

android c cipher-suites cryptography dtls iot-security java jni jsse ocsp openjdk openssl-alternative openssl-library security ssl tls tls-library tls13 wolfssl

Last synced: 13 Oct 2024

https://github.com/dajiaji/hpke-js

A Hybrid Public Key Encryption (HPKE) module built on top of Web Cryptography API.

aead cryptography encryption hpke kdf kem kyber ml-kem post-quantum pqc rfc9180 security webcrypto x-wing

Last synced: 12 Nov 2024

https://github.com/sopium/noise-rust

Rust implementation of Noise

crypto cryptography noise noise-protocol-framework rust

Last synced: 01 Sep 2024

https://github.com/youngqqcn/qblockchainnotes

匚块é“ū垀发å­Ķäđ įŽ”čŪ°(持įŧ­æ›ī新...)

bitcoin blockchain cryptography ethereum exchange monero

Last synced: 14 Nov 2024

https://github.com/potatosalad/ruby-jose

JSON Object Signing and Encryption (JOSE) for Ruby

cryptography jose jwt ruby

Last synced: 15 Nov 2024

https://github.com/blckngm/noise-rust

Rust implementation of Noise

crypto cryptography noise noise-protocol-framework rust

Last synced: 28 Oct 2024

https://github.com/gakonst/dark-forest

[WIP] Rust implementation of the Dark Forest game client

cryptography dark-forest ethereum rust

Last synced: 22 Oct 2024

https://github.com/garbados/comdb

A PouchDB plugin that transparently encrypts and decrypts its data.

couchdb cryptography pouchdb

Last synced: 16 Nov 2024

https://github.com/ecadlabs/signatory

Signatory - A Tezos Remote Signer for signing block-chain operations with private keys using YubiHSM, AWS, GCP, Ledger's or Azure Key Vault

aws-kms azure-keyvault cryptography gcp-kms hsm kms ledger-wallet tezos tezos-baking yubihsm

Last synced: 13 Nov 2024

https://github.com/kaushalmeena/digi-cloak

A web app that hides secrets in plain sight securely in images with the help of AES encryption and LSB steganography technique.

angular cryptography html scss steganography

Last synced: 09 Nov 2024

https://github.com/jezachen/ssepy

SSEPy: Implementation of searchable symmetric encryption in pure Python

cryptography encryption python searchable-encryption searchable-symmetric-encryption security sse

Last synced: 28 Oct 2024

https://github.com/trailofbits/reverie

An efficient and generalized implementation of the IKOS-style KKW proof system (https://eprint.iacr.org/2018/475) for arbitrary rings.

blake3 crypto cryptography nizk rust-lang zk zkproof-prover

Last synced: 08 Nov 2024

https://github.com/adria0/plonk-by-fingers

Implementation of Plonk by Hand in rust

cryptography plonk rust

Last synced: 05 Nov 2024

https://github.com/cretz/gopaque

Go implementation of OPAQUE (hidden password user registration and auth)

cryptography opaque pake

Last synced: 27 Oct 2024

https://github.com/jedisct1/libaegis

Portable C implementations of the AEGIS family of high-performance authenticated encryption algorithms.

aead aegis aegis128l aegis128x aegis256 aegis256x cipher cryptography libaegis

Last synced: 18 Oct 2024

https://github.com/aegis-aead/libaegis

Portable C implementations of the AEGIS family of high-performance authenticated encryption algorithms.

aead aegis aegis128l aegis128x aegis256 aegis256x cipher cryptography libaegis

Last synced: 14 Nov 2024

https://github.com/ZenGo-X/class

Rust library for building IQC: cryptography based on class groups of imaginary quadratic orders

blockchain-technology class-groups cryptography math pari

Last synced: 08 Nov 2024

https://github.com/thor314/pebble-stark

A community-developed re-implementation of the Starkware Stone Prover

cairo community cryptography prover stark starkware zero-knowledge zk

Last synced: 29 Oct 2024

https://github.com/nagyesta/lowkey-vault

Lowkey Vault is a small test double for Azure Key Vault. Developer feedback needed, please vote here: https://github.com/nagyesta/lowkey-vault/discussions/272

azure ci cryptography fake-objects keyvault local test-double

Last synced: 15 Nov 2024

https://github.com/mattrglobal/node-bbs-signatures

An implementation of BBS+ signatures using rust and typescript for node.js

assurance cryptography digital-signature nucleus zero-knowledge-proofs

Last synced: 07 Nov 2024

https://github.com/tf-encrypted/moose

Secure distributed dataflow framework for encrypted machine learning and data processing

cryptography data-science distributed-computing machine-learning privacy secure-computation

Last synced: 06 Nov 2024

https://github.com/taurushq-io/frost-ed25519

Implementation of the FROST protocol for threshold Ed25519 signing

cryptography multi-party-computation signature

Last synced: 08 Nov 2024

https://github.com/grosquildu/cryptoattacks

Implementation of attacks on cryptosystems

cryptoanalysis cryptography ctf-tools

Last synced: 08 Nov 2024

https://gitlab.com/kovri-project/kovri

The Kovri Project | router repo

C++ anonymity cryptography i2p monero networking privacy

Last synced: 30 Oct 2024

https://archlinuxstudio.github.io/LinuxNetworkProgrammingAndEncryption/

âœĻLinux į―‘įŧœįž–įĻ‹äļŽåŠ åŊ†| 包åŦ C čŊ­čĻ€įž–įĻ‹äļ­æ˜“凚įŽ°įš„é™·é˜ą čūƒéšūį†č§Ģįš„įŸĨčŊ†į‚đ 重į‚đ内åŪđ将包åŦåŪžæˆ˜įš„į―‘įŧœįž–įĻ‹å†…åŪđ äŧĨ及创åŧšåŪ‰å…Ļ通äŋĄįš„加åŊ†å†…åŪđ | 提äū›åœĻįšŋį―‘éĄĩ文æĄĢ âœĻ

archlinux book c chinese cryptography libev libsodium linux network networking shadowsocks shadowsocks-libev socks sodium

Last synced: 17 Nov 2024

https://github.com/dajiaji/pyseto

A Python implementation of PASETO and PASERK.

cryptography encryption paserk paseto python security signature token

Last synced: 12 Nov 2024

https://github.com/racum/rust-djangohashers

A Rust port of the password primitives used in Django Project.

algorithm argon2 bcrypt cryptography django hashes password password-hash pbkdf2 rust rust-port

Last synced: 27 Oct 2024

https://github.com/bascht/omemo-top

Tracking the Progress of OMEMO Integration in various clients

cryptography jabber omemo website xmpp

Last synced: 14 Nov 2024

https://github.com/archlinuxstudio/linuxnetworkprogrammingandencryption

âœĻLinux į―‘įŧœįž–įĻ‹äļŽåŠ åŊ†| 包åŦ C čŊ­čĻ€įž–įĻ‹äļ­æ˜“凚įŽ°įš„é™·é˜ą čūƒéšūį†č§Ģįš„įŸĨčŊ†į‚đ 重į‚đ内åŪđ将包åŦåŪžæˆ˜įš„į―‘įŧœįž–įĻ‹å†…åŪđ äŧĨ及创åŧšåŪ‰å…Ļ通äŋĄįš„加åŊ†å†…åŪđ | 提äū›åœĻįšŋį―‘éĄĩ文æĄĢ âœĻ

archlinux book c chinese cryptography libev libsodium linux network networking shadowsocks shadowsocks-libev socks sodium

Last synced: 10 Nov 2024

https://github.com/SSProve/ssprove

A foundational framework for modular cryptographic proofs in Coq

coq-formalization coq-library cryptography formal-verification modular-cryptographic-proofs state-separating-proofs

Last synced: 18 Nov 2024

https://github.com/leocavalcante/password-dart

A set of high-level APIs over PointyCastle and CryptoUtils to hash and verify passwords securely.

cryptography dart digest hash password pbkdf2

Last synced: 20 Oct 2024

https://github.com/47ng/cloak

Serialized AES-GCM 256 encryption, decryption and key management in the browser & Node.js

aes-256-gcm cli cryptography decryption encryption

Last synced: 14 Nov 2024

https://github.com/starkware-libs/starkware-crypto-utils

Signatures, keys and Pedersen hash on STARK friendly elliptic curve

cryptography curve ec elliptic javascript signature stark starkex starkex-crypto starkware wallet

Last synced: 05 Nov 2024

https://github.com/noot/ring-go

💍implementation of linkable ring signatures in go

cryptography proof-of-membership ring-signatures zk

Last synced: 15 Nov 2024

https://github.com/dusk-network/dusk-zerocaf

Zerocaf: A library built for EC operations in Zero Knowledge.

bulletproofs cryptography cryptography-library elliptic-curve-cryptography ristretto

Last synced: 02 Nov 2024

https://github.com/zcash/orchard

Implementation of the Zcash Orchard Protocol

cryptocurrency cryptography zcash

Last synced: 04 Aug 2024

https://github.com/antagon/TCHunt-ng

Reveal encrypted files stored on a filesystem.

cryptography encryption forensics security truecrypt

Last synced: 18 Nov 2024

https://github.com/Open-Attestation/open-attestation

Meta framework for providing digital provenance and integrity to documents.

cryptography ethereum openattestation pki signature

Last synced: 04 Aug 2024

https://github.com/simplelegal/pocket_protector

🔏 People-centric secret management system, built to work with modern distributed version control systems.

configuration cryptography infrastructure secret-management tools

Last synced: 06 Nov 2024

https://github.com/openca/libpki

Easy-to-use high-level library for PKI-enabled applications

c cryptography hsm ocsp openssl pki x509certificates

Last synced: 08 Nov 2024

https://github.com/juliacrypto/nettle.jl

Julia wrapper around nettle cryptographic hashing/encryption library providing MD5, SHA1, SHA2 hashing and HMAC functionality, as well as AES encryption/decryption

cryptography encryption hash-algorithms hmac-functionality julia nettle wrapper-library

Last synced: 31 Oct 2024

https://github.com/SpinalHDL/SpinalCrypto

SpinalHDL - Cryptography libraries

aes crc crypto cryptography des fpga hmac md5 rtl scala sha spinalhdl verilog vhdl

Last synced: 09 Nov 2024

https://github.com/mobilecoinfoundation/mc-oblivious

ORAM and related for Intel SGX enclaves

cryptography no-std

Last synced: 11 Nov 2024

https://github.com/tyrchen/cellar

A password tool for user to derive a large amount of application passwords deterministically based on a passphrase. Cryptographically strong.

cryptography password security

Last synced: 07 Aug 2024

https://github.com/vpaliy/merklelib

Merkle trees for easier data verification.

bitcoin crypto cryptography hash-tree merkle-tree

Last synced: 30 Oct 2024

https://github.com/j2kun/finite-fields

Python code and tests for the post 'Programming with Finite Fields'

algorithms cryptography finite-fields mathematics

Last synced: 10 Nov 2024

https://github.com/xoofx/monocypher.net

.NET wrapper around the cryptographic library Monocypher https://monocypher.org/

argon2i blake2b cryptography dotnet eddsa25519 x25519 xchacha20-poly1305

Last synced: 05 Nov 2024

https://github.com/SmartTokenLabs/attestation

Paper and implementation of blockchain attestations

blockchain-attestations cryptography ethereum identity-attestations web3

Last synced: 15 Nov 2024

https://github.com/bartobri/mrrcrypt

A command line encryption/decryption tool using an adaptive mirror field algorithm.

crypto cryptography encryption

Last synced: 15 Oct 2024

https://github.com/capeprivacy/tf-world-tutorial

TensorFlow World 2019 Tutorial: Privacy-Preserving Machine Learning with TF Encrypted & PySyft

cryptography deep-learning privacy secure-computation tensorflow

Last synced: 07 Nov 2024

https://github.com/spinalhdl/spinalcrypto

SpinalHDL - Cryptography libraries

aes crc crypto cryptography des fpga hmac md5 rtl scala sha spinalhdl verilog vhdl

Last synced: 05 Nov 2024

https://github.com/rubycrypto/x25519

Public key cryptography library for Ruby providing the X25519 Diffie-Hellman function

cryptography curve25519 diffie-hellman elliptic-curves x25519

Last synced: 15 Nov 2024

https://github.com/github/darrrr

An SDK for the delegated recovery specfication

authentication cryptography facebook federation rails ruby ruby-on-rails sinatra

Last synced: 29 Sep 2024

https://github.com/juliacrypto/sha.jl

A performant, 100% native-julia SHA1, SHA2, and SHA3 implementation

cryptography hash-functions julia sha1 sha2 sha3

Last synced: 18 Nov 2024

https://github.com/tuxxy/iacr-eprint-mirror

Mirror of all PDFs from the IACR's eprint

cryptography mathematics research security

Last synced: 10 Nov 2024

https://github.com/corvuscodex/multithread-bitcoin-brute-force-for-segwit-addresses

This is a Node.js script that uses multiple worker processes to generate random private keys for Bitcoin Segwit addresses are also known as Bech32 wallets and check if they match any of the Segwit addresses are also known as Bech32 addresses in a file named `data.txt`

bitcoin bitcoin-bruteforce bitcoin-cracker bitcoin-hacking bitcoin-miner bitcoin-segwit bitcoin-wallet bitcoin-wallet-bruteforce bitcoin-wallet-cracker bitcoin-wallet-recover bitcoin-wallet-recovery-tool brute-force bruteforce colider crypto cryptography private-key seed segwit walletminer

Last synced: 30 Oct 2024

https://github.com/azadkuh/mbedcrypto

a portable, small, easy to use and fast c++14 library for cryptography.

aes-encryption cipher cpp cpp11 cpp14 crypto cryptography mbedtls qt5 rsa-cryptography

Last synced: 11 Nov 2024

https://github.com/virgilsecurity/demo-sharing-js

This is a demo app shows how you can create a secure file sharing app using Virgil Crypto Library in Javascript.

cryptography demo encryption file-sharing sharing

Last synced: 09 Nov 2024

https://github.com/noot/schnorr-verify

super cheap solidity schnorr sig verification using only ecrecover and keccak256

cryptography ethereum schnorr solidity

Last synced: 22 Oct 2024

https://github.com/benwestgate/bails

Bails is a Bitcoin solution protecting against surveillance, censorship, and confiscation. It installs Bitcoin Core to Tails encrypted Persistent Storage, creates and recovers Bitcoin Core wallets from Codex32 (BIP93) seed backups, and creates backup Bails USB sticks and shareable blank Bails USB sticks. Learn more in README.md.

anonymous bash bip85 bitcoin bitcoin-core bitcoin-wallet bootable-usb codex32 cryptography gtk install-script linux luks privacy python qrcode security shamir-secret-sharing tails tor

Last synced: 11 Oct 2024

https://github.com/tgalal/dissononce

A python implementation for Noise Protocol Framework

crypto-library cryptography handshake-protocol noise-protocol noise-protocol-framework

Last synced: 07 Nov 2024

https://github.com/adorsys/datasafe

Datasafe - flexible and secure data storage and document sharing using cryptographic message syntax for data encryption

cloud-storage cryptographic-message-system cryptography data-encryption document-storage encrypted-store file-sharing graal-native java library privacy s3-encryption security vault

Last synced: 15 Nov 2024